How much does a Category Manager make?
A Category Manager plays a key role in the supply chain and retail sectors. They focus on managing specific product categories to ensure profitability and customer satisfaction. The average yearly salary for a Category Manager is around $91,275. This figure can vary based on experience, location, and the specific industry.
Salary ranges for Category Managers can differ significantly. Some earn as little as $29,750, while others can make over $176,700 per year. Here are some key points to consider:
- Entry-level positions often start around $29,750.
- Mid-career managers can expect to earn between $69,827 and $123,264.
- Experienced managers in top positions can make over $176,700.

How to earn more as a Category Manager?
To increase earnings as a Category Manager, focus on several key areas. Start by gaining experience in high-demand categories. This can lead to higher-paying positions. Building strong relationships with suppliers and vendors also helps. These connections can lead to better deals and cost savings. Another factor is mastering data analysis. This skill helps in making informed decisions that boost profitability. Continuous learning and staying updated with industry trends also play a role. This ensures that a Category Manager remains competitive. Lastly, effective communication skills are crucial. They help in negotiating better terms and aligning with company goals.
